Derrick,
Your problem could be a defective fuel accumulator or time temperature
switch. Contact us directly for instructions on how to test each component.

> This should be an easy one for all of the DeLoorean veterans out there.
> Here is the problem, My car sits in a garage right now, and I try to get
> over to it once a week to start it and let it run, and sometimes drive
> it(weather permitting). When I first get there after it has sat for about
a
> week and crank it over it will usually start on the first try, then stall,
> and then I start it up again and it purrs like a kitten. I am sure it
would
> run all day if I left it. But when I turn it off like after a drive and
> then try to start it again it has a really hard time starting again, once
in
> a while it will start with a little struggle, but most times I have to use
a
> squirt of starting fluid. When I do that it starts up then runs fine
until
> I shut it off again. It seems that it is not getting fuel after I shut it
> off and then try to start it again, am I right? Could this be a problem
> with the accumulator? The fuel pump was replaced by the previous owner.
> Any help is welcomed.
